IEventSubscription::GetPublisherPropertyCollection method (eventsys.h)

Retrieves a collection of properties and values stored in the publisher property bag.

Syntax

HRESULT GetPublisherPropertyCollection(
  [out, retval] IEventObjectCollection **collection
);

Parameters

[out, retval] collection

Address of a pointer to the IEventObjectCollection interface on an event object collection. This parameter cannot be NULL.

Return value

This method can return the standard return values E_INVALIDARG, E_POINTER, E_OUTOFMEMORY, E_UNEXPECTED, E_FAIL, and S_OK.

Remarks

A property bag is used to store information about the events the subscriber needs to be notified about. For example, if a subscriber to a sports ticker is to obtain only baseball scores, it could use the property bag in the subscription object to specify this restriction.

Requirements

Requirement Value
Minimum supported client Windows 2000 Professional [desktop apps only]
Minimum supported server Windows 2000 Server [desktop apps only]
Target Platform Windows
Header eventsys.h

See also

IEventSubscription